Green Chile And Olive Dip

ingredients
2 tablespoons wine vinegar
1 tablespoon oil
2 cans (4 ounce size) diced green chiles
2 cans (4.25 ounce size) chopped ripe olives
3 medium tomatoes, diced
4 green onions, chopped
salt and pepper, to taste
1 tablespoon cilantro, chopped (optional)
directions
Mix all ingredients and refrigerate for at least one hour before serving with tortilla chips.
Recipe Source: Maria A. Byers, "20 Years of Good Taste, Mission Viejo's Community Cookbook"
